DAY 1: From Primošten to the islands Žirje or Kakan

Primošten is a small town and municipality in Šibenik - Knin County, located 20 kilometers south of Šibenik. This picturesque town with its interesting architecture and beautiful surroundings attracts many tourists. Near Primošten lies a beautiful marina Kremik. Marina has capacity of 400 sea berths and 150 land berths, and offers a lot of extra facilities for guests. As you will probably start after 17:00 local time you will have just enough time to sail to islands Žirje or Kakan.

Žirje is the most distant permanently inhabited island of Šibenik archipelago, and also the largest. It is located 20 kilometers southwest from Šibenik. Island Žirje has a very indented coastline with numerous bays surrounded by lots of rocks reefs and islets. The main settlement on the island is Žirje with about 100 inhabitants who are mainly engaged in production olives grapes figs. On south side of the island is beautiful bay Velika Stupica, with two stone houses and tavern Stupica.

Kakan is Dalmatian island located near the town of Šibenik, west form the island of Žirje. The island is uninhabited, except in the summer when it is visited by tourists in search of rest and relaxation. Except the anchorage in the Borovnjaci bay, also there is a dock in Tratica bay on the north side of the island with a restaurant. After overnight on islands Žirje or Kakan, route continues towards to the island Zlarin.

DAY 2: From the islands Žirje or Kakan - island Zlarin - town of Skradin

Zlarin is a small Dalmatian island located in the Šibenik archipelago, 12 nautical miles from the town of Skradin. Zlarin is surrounded by many small uninhabited islands and crystal clear sea, and is known for its beautiful beaches and coral. On Zlarin there are few restaurants and taverns where you can taste the famous Dalmatian and island specialties. After enjoying, swimming, sunbathing and rest on Zlarin, visit the town of Skradin.

Skradin is a small picturesque town on the right side of the river Krka, at the entrance to the Krka National Park, 18 km north of Šibenik. With its rich history dating back from Illyrian and Roman times, Skradin is one of the oldest Croatian cities. Dine at one of the many Skradin restaurants and enjoy traditional dishes under the lid, Skradin brodetto or the Skradin cake. Anchor in a beautiful ACI marina Skradin or in the restaurant Vidrovac before the bridge. Happy host Vlatko will gladly take you to Skradin with his boat, and of course bring back to the boat after the trip. In the morning, continue the route to island Tijat.

DAY 3: From Skradin - island Tijat - island Kaprije

Tijat is an island located south of town of Vodice, and west of the island of Prvić, 8.5 nm from the island of Kakan. The island is uninhabited, covered with underbrush and difficult cultivable. On the south side of island is bay Tijašćica, a favorite resort and anchorage for yachtsmen and is ideal for swimming and a break. After the break, continue the route to the island of Kaprije.

Kaprije island is located 15 km southwest of Šibenik. Island is rich with fruitful valleys where grows olives and grapes, and clean air and pleasant surrounding attracts many tourists who want to get away from city crowds and relax. The only settlement on the island is Kaprije, situated in the bay of St. Peter and protected from strong winds. Kaprije has a shop and several restaurants and taverns. After overnight on Kaprije, in the morning sail off to the islands Ravni Žakan or Smokvica Vela.

DAY 4: From island Kaprije - islands Smokvica Vela or Ravni Žakan - island Piškera

Smokvica Vela uninhabited island of Kornati archipelago, southwest of Cape Opat. On the south side of the island is located a Lojena bay. In the bay there are two taverns with moorings, Piccolo and Mare.

Ravni Žakan is a small island on the south of the Kornati archipelago. On the south side of the island there is a Žakan bay. In the bay is located famous tavern Žakan known for delicious seafood specialties and a pleasant ambience, and in front of the tavern is a pier with electricity and water supply. After swimming and resting on Ravni Žakan, head to the island Piškera. After bathing and dining on the islands Ravni Žakan or Smokvica Vela, set sail for the island of Piškera.

Piškera is the second largest island in Kornati archipelago. Although uninhabited, and acts as a deserted island, Piškera comes alive in summer times. Island Piškera is an integral part of the National Park Kornati, and next to its coast pass away numerous excursion and charter boats. Between the islands of Piškera and the islet Vela Panitula is a beautiful ACI marina Piškera with 120 berths. In the marina there is restaurant, exchange office and shop. Next morning sail away to island Levrnaka.

DAY 5: From island Piškera - island Levrnaka - Telašćica bay

Levrnaka is a small island in the Kornati archipelago, located 6 nm from Telašćica. On the southwest coast of the island is a beautiful sandy beach Lojena where tourists often come with boats on bathing. On the island of Levrnaka there are two small restaurants on the opposite coast of the island. Afternoon saila away to the Telašćica bay.

Telašćica bay, by which the whole nature park is named, is located on the southeastern part of the island of Dugi otok and is one of the safest, most beautiful and largest natural harbors in the Adriatic. Nature Park Telašćica features three basic phenomena: Telašćica bay, cliffs or so-called ‘stene’ of Dugi Otok which rise to 200 m above the sea, and a medicinal salt lake Mir. In the Telašćice there are several restaurants where you can enjoy in traditional local specialties. Anchoring and overnight stay on boats is allowed in bays in the park. In the morning sail away to the island Žut.

DAY 6: From Telašćica bay - island Žut - village Jezera on the island Murter

Žut is the second largest island in the Kornati archipelago, located between island of Pašman and Kornat. The island is covered with olive trees, fig trees and grape vines that are mainly grown by inhabitants of the island of Murter. Žut is adorned with numerous picturesque bays which are suitable and safe for anchoring, souch as Strunac bay, Dragišina bay and Bizikovac bay. On the island there are several taverns and restaurants. On the north coast of the island is ACI marina Žut, with capacity of 135 berths. After bathing and dining on the island of Žut, afternoon sail to the village Jezera on island Murter.

Jezera is a small place on the southeast coast of the island of Murter, in a natural protected bay. Jezera was first mentioned in the 13th century, but the history of colonization of Jezera dates from the time of Liburns. Population of Jezera, besides tourism, deals with wine, olive oil and extraction of sand and stones. Jezera has several restaurants and cafes, shop and post office. Although a small place, Jezera dispose with over 1000 accommodation possibilities. In the Jezera bay there is ACI marina Jezera with a capacity of 200 berths. After overnight in Jezera, follows the return to Primošten.

DAY 7: From village Jezera to Primošten

Thanks to rich tourist content, Primošten is one of the most popular tourist destinations on the Adriatic. Primošten offers a rich gastronomic offer, great nightlife, lots of outdoor activities and the organization of excursions. Primošten is adorned with beautiful pebble and sandy beaches, from which the most famous is beautiful beach Raduča.
